So führst du sie aus

  1. 1Preparation and positioning. Set both rings to equal height, verify the anchors and straps, and clear the space beneath and around you. Check overhead clearance and place a stable step where a controlled dismount is possible.
  2. 2Starting position. Take the prescribed closed grip and begin with extended elbows in a controlled hang. Set the ribcage over the pelvis and keep the legs quiet.
  3. 3Concentric phase. Initiate a smooth pull by driving the elbows and upper arms down while controlling the shoulder girdle. Raise the body as one unit without a leg kick, hip pop, or cyclical swing.
  4. 4End position / lockout. Reach the chosen standard—normally chin clearly above the hand/bar line—with a neutral head and controlled shoulders. Keep the same standard across the set.
  5. 5Eccentric phase. Lower under control to the defined straight-arm start without dropping the final portion or allowing assistance to snap you downward.
  6. 6Breathing and bracing. Brace before the pull, exhale through the hardest portion as appropriate, and reset the breath in the controlled hang. Avoid prolonged breath-holding across multiple reps.
  7. 7Valid rep. The rep starts from the same extended-elbow position, reaches the defined top marker without kipping, and returns under control; grip, assistance, and range remain unchanged.

Häufige Fehler

  • Using trunk or leg momentum

    Korrektur: Make the body quiet, lower the difficulty, and initiate the pull through the upper arms.

  • Shrugging through the pull

    Korrektur: Keep the neck long and let the scapulae move under control rather than collapsing toward the ears.

  • Cutting the lower range

    Korrektur: Return to the same controlled straight-arm marker on every rep.

  • Jutting the head to reach

    Korrektur: Keep the head neutral and move the chest/body to the fixed marker.

Sicherheit

  • Prüf beide Verankerungen und Gurte, gleich die Ringhöhe an und halte eine freie Fallzone; ein Versagen von Gurt oder Verankerung kann einen plötzlichen Sturz verursachen.
  • Nutz nur einen schmerzfreien Bewegungsumfang über Kopf, den du kontrollieren kannst; aktuelle Schultersymptome oder ein deutlicher Seitenunterschied im Bewegungsumfang erfordern eine individuelle Abklärung, statt die Lehrbuchposition zu erzwingen.
